Job description

Assisting Clients with all aspects of their personal care whilst always maintaining the privacy of theClient.

Responsibilities
  • To assist Clients in using their personal and mobility aids whilst ensuring all aids are well maintained.
  • Assist social activities by interacting with clients and helping them to continue with their hobbies andactivities to the best of your ability.
  • To understand, contribute to and be familiar with the Clients Care Plans and report any changes to thePerson in Charge.
  • To complete accurate and effective written records as instructed in line with policies and procedures.
  • Assist Clients during mealtimes in accordance with their care plan and serve meals and drinks as required.
  • To answer the nurse call system promptly and give assistance as required.
  • To report any incidents, occurrences or complaints to the Nurse in Charge and record appropriately.
  • To attend mandatory training and other training identified to enable you to fulfil your role is compulsory.
  • This may involve travel to other venues and in some cases additional costs for training.
  • To attend supervision and appraisal meetings and Narra Care Services staff meetings as required.
  • Any other duties as are within the scope, spirit and purpose of the job.
  • Good written and spoken English required for 1:1 work and record keeping.
Skills and Qualifications
  • 6 Months care experience preferred but not essential.
  • Self-motivated and a willingness to learn.
  • Organised.
  • Caring and sensitive to the needs of others.Active team player.
  • Flexible.Able to work on own initiative.
